### Step 4 — Sign your font bundle

After vendoring third-party fonts into your Quillmont plugin, package them under assets/fonts and generate a manifest. The Quillmont marketplace rejects unsigned bundles, so sign the manifest before upload. Licensing metadata must be embedded per font file. Sign using the marketplace deploy key shown below.

deploy key for tahof-yadup: bky6_JWeaJq

## Read-Replica Lag Alarm

New folks: the ReplicaLagHigh alarm covers the Ostrel reporting replicas. It fires when lag exceeds 90 seconds for five minutes. Most triggers come from the nightly Bramwell export job, which is expected and auto-resolves. Do not fail over the replica yourself — that requires the data-platform lead's approval and a change ticket. If the alarm persists past 20 minutes with no export running, write to the platform inbox.

billing contact of yahip-yadup = eliax.druix@zemvarworks.corp

Hey — quick note on the flaky prefetcher job before you approve. TileHoard's CI keeps timing out on the zoom-level-14 prefetch test, but only on the shared runners. Turns out the mock tile server binds a fixed port, and parallel jobs collide, so the prefetcher retries until the timeout. I've switched it to an ephemeral port in this branch; runs are green three times in a row now. If you want to double-check the last red run yourself, pull the trace with the token below.

trace token, fafog-kageg: htk4_98e6

**Mgmt Meeting Minutes — Retiring the Brightline Range**

Quick recap for sales leads at Fenholt Supplies: we agreed to retire the Brightline fixture range by year-end. Remaining stock moves to clearance pricing next month, and accounts on standing orders get migrated to the Lumetta range. Trade-in incentives were approved in principle. The confidential note on next steps sits just below.

board note of bajof-bajeg: The pricing group signed off on a budget of $13.4 million for Project Sildor. The renewal with Lamixek Holdings closes at $48.9 million a year, 49 percent above the last contract.